Automated liquid handling robots (a class of devices that can include automated pipetting systems as well as microplate washers) dispense and sample liquids in tubes or wells and are often integrated as automated injection modules as the front end of liquid chromatographic systems. These critical labor saving devices offer precision sample preparation for high throughput screening/sequencing (HTC), liquid or powder weighing, sample preparation, and bio-assays of many kinds. The automated pipetting systems handle volumes ranging from .5 ul to 5 L. These units may have built in components in order to feed samples into heating and cooling systems for thermal cycling or shaking systems depending on the target application, or are physically constructed for easy integration with peripheral labware. Liquid handlers with robotic arms allow the user to program the devices to manipulate external labware to extend the systems uses. Other desirable features include programs to control start/stop functions and to choreograph sequential steps necessary for chemical and biochemical assays and for injection options.

Build Complex Assays Quickly The flexibility, speed, accuracy, and precision of the Echo 525 Liquid Handler enable researchers to build assays that are not possible with traditional liquid handlers. The use of acoustic sound energy removes the traditional boundaries of tip and pin tool based liquid handlers. Transfer variable fluid heights and viscosities from one source plate to enable rapid assay creation in one fluid transfer run. Say goodbye to fixed plate designs as the Echo Liquid Handler moves fluids from any well to any well enabling researchers to design the experimental plates they need to make new discoveries. Efficiently Transfer Build Reagents with Echo Qualified Reservoir Assay assembly and the transfer of one reagent to many wells is simplified using the Echo Qualified Reservoir. With the capability of transferring up to 2.5 µL from each micro-well, you can build your assay without requiring an instrument change – saving time and money. Flexible and Reliable Transfer of Genomic Reagents The Echo 525 Liquid Handler transfers a wide range of fluids during one transfer including distilled water, buffers, nucleic acids, and reagents containing up to 50% glycerol. With its versatile fluid range, transfer volume range, any well to any well transfer capability, and powerful applications software the Echo 525 Liquid Handler supports a wide range of genomic assay workflows: - Gene Synthesis
- PCR and qPCR assay set-up
- RNA and DNA NGS sequencing workflows
- Sanger sequencing assay set-up
- Single-cell sample preparation

PAT700 TOC Analyzer Overview PAT700 Total Organic Carbon (TOC) Analyzers are specifically designed to help demonstrate compliance to the pharmacopoeial requirements for TOC and conductivity for Purified Water and Water For Injection. - TOC, Uncompensated Conductivity and Temperature from just one analyzer – can be fully calibrated and validated to USP<643> and USP<645>
- Low cost of ownership – 12 month service and calibration intervals
- Root-cause analysis support – water sample automatically taken if there is a TOC excursion
- All SOPs are pre-loaded into the PAT700, leading users step-by step with on-screen pictures and prompts
PAT700 TOC Analyzer Features Low cost of ownership - 12 month service intervals supported by auto-switching Main and Standby UV oxidation lamps with UV output monitoring
- No chemicals/reagents required – PAT700 just uses strong UV lamps to oxidize TOC
- No peristaltic pump tubing or pump heads to replace – PAT700 uses water system pressure to push sample into measurement cell for analysis
Root-cause analysis support - User can pre-program the PAT700 so that at a pre-determined TOC level, it will capture a water sample which can then be later analyzed in the QC Lab to assist root cause analysis should a TOC excursion be detected
- On-board grab sampler allows the user to take samples from different locations/use points to support root cause analysis
Improved compliance - PAT700 can be fully calibrated and validated for compliance to USP<643> for TOC and USP<645> for conductivity
- Complete oxidation to EP 2.2.44 requirements – the PAT700 ensures complete TOC oxidation through oxidation dynamic end-point detection
- 21CFR part 11 support – everyday users can view TOC and Conductivity results as a Guest without the ability to make any changes to the PAT700. Initial configuration and subsequent changes are protected through multi-level user name and password protection
- Dual-stream version available to demonstrate compliance both at the start and end of water loops simultaneously
Reduced training burden – no manual calculations/data entry - All SOPs are pre-loaded into the PAT700, leading users step-by step with on-screen pictures and prompts
- All Calibration and System Suitability standards come with certified value data and use by dates programmed into an RFID tag on the bottle itself. Following the on-screen SOPs the user is prompted to load the bottles and the PAT700 then reads the RFID tags on the bottles. If the bottles have been loaded in the wrong order, or if they have expired the PAT700 provides a warning on the touch-screen. The PAT700 then uploads certified values, carries out the test and automatically calculates a pass/fail result and provides a report.
